La madurez digital a través del Desarrollo de Sistemas de Diseño: Una perspectiva técnica y estratég

29/08/2024 Experiencia de Usuario y Diseño UI/UX
La madurez digital a través del Desarrollo de Sistemas de Diseño: Una perspectiva técnica y estratég

En el panorama actual de la creación de productos digitales, la velocidad y la coherencia no pueden seguir siendo conceptos antagónicos. Tras una década gestionando ecosistemas complejos en OUNTI, hemos observado que la mayoría de las empresas no sufren por falta de talento creativo, sino por un exceso de deuda técnica y visual. Aquí es donde el Desarrollo de Sistemas de Diseño deja de ser una tendencia para convertirse en la infraestructura crítica de cualquier organización que aspire a escalar con eficiencia. No hablamos simplemente de un conjunto de componentes en Figma o una librería de React; hablamos de un lenguaje vivo que actúa como la única fuente de verdad para diseñadores, desarrolladores y stakeholders.

La entropía es el enemigo natural de las interfaces de usuario. A medida que un producto crece, las inconsistencias se multiplican: botones con cuatro variantes de azul, modales que se comportan de forma distinta según la sección y un código CSS que se vuelve inmanejable. El Desarrollo de Sistemas de Diseño aborda este caos mediante la sistematización de patrones y la creación de una gramática visual compartida. Como expertos en el sector, entendemos que un sistema exitoso no se mide por la cantidad de componentes que posee, sino por la frecuencia con la que se reutilizan y la facilidad con la que se pueden actualizar sin romper el ecosistema global.


La anatomía de la eficiencia: Más allá de los componentes atómicos

Para profundizar en el Desarrollo de Sistemas de Diseño, debemos desglosar su estructura interna. Inspirados en metodologías como el Atomic Design de Brad Frost, en OUNTI estructuramos la arquitectura digital partiendo de los átomos (colores, tipografías, espaciados) hasta llegar a las páginas completas. Sin embargo, el verdadero poder reside en los "Design Tokens". Estos son los valores más pequeños de la interfaz, como un código hexadecimal o un valor de padding, representados por un nombre semántico. Al utilizar tokens, una modificación en el valor de una variable se propaga automáticamente a todas las plataformas, ya sea web, iOS o Android.

Esta capacidad de orquestación es vital cuando trabajamos en mercados geográficamente diversos. Por ejemplo, nuestra capacidad para gestionar proyectos de diseño en el lugar Alicante nos permite entender la necesidad de adaptabilidad local bajo una estructura global. El sistema permite que el producto mantenga su identidad mientras se adapta a las necesidades específicas de cada región o unidad de negocio. Sin esta base, cada nueva página o funcionalidad se convierte en un esfuerzo de "borrón y cuenta nueva", lo que drena los recursos financieros y humanos de la agencia y del cliente.

La documentación es el corazón latente de este proceso. Un sistema de diseño sin documentación es solo una hoja de estilos glorificada. Según las directrices de la Nielsen Norman Group, la claridad en las reglas de uso es lo que garantiza que la experiencia del usuario sea predecible y accesible. En OUNTI, nos aseguramos de que cada componente tenga una definición clara de su "por qué", no solo de su "cómo", estableciendo pautas de accesibilidad (WCAG) desde el primer pixel.


Impacto en sectores verticales: De la salud a los servicios industriales

El Desarrollo de Sistemas de Diseño no es exclusivo de las grandes tecnológicas de Silicon Valley; su aplicación en sectores específicos genera un retorno de inversión (ROI) tangible. Consideremos el sector del bienestar. En el desarrollo de plataformas para coaches de salud, la confianza es el pilar fundamental. Un sistema de diseño sólido garantiza que cada interacción, desde la reserva de una cita hasta el seguimiento de un plan nutricional, se sienta familiar y segura. La consistencia visual reduce la carga cognitiva del usuario, permitiéndole centrarse en sus objetivos de salud en lugar de descifrar cómo navegar la herramienta.

De igual forma, sectores más tradicionales encuentran en la sistematización una ventaja competitiva. El diseño web para empresas de fontanería o servicios técnicos industriales puede parecer, a priori, un escenario donde un sistema de diseño es excesivo. Nada más lejos de la realidad. En estos casos, la velocidad de carga y la facilidad para encontrar información de contacto en dispositivos móviles son críticas. Un sistema optimizado permite desplegar landing pages de alta conversión en tiempo récord, asegurando que la marca mantenga un aspecto profesional y robusto, sin importar cuántas subpáginas de servicios se necesiten crear para el posicionamiento SEO.

Incluso en nuestra expansión internacional, al abordar proyectos en el lugar Caivano, hemos comprobado que la barrera del idioma se mitiga cuando los patrones de diseño son universales y lógicos. El desarrollo de sistemas de diseño permite que los equipos multidisciplinares hablen el mismo idioma técnico, reduciendo los tiempos de handoff entre diseño y desarrollo hasta en un 40%.


La gobernanza y el ciclo de vida del sistema

Uno de los errores más comunes tras diez años en la industria es pensar que el Desarrollo de Sistemas de Diseño termina con el lanzamiento de la librería. Un sistema que no evoluciona, muere. La gobernanza es el proceso de decidir cómo se añaden, modifican o eliminan componentes del sistema. En OUNTI, promovemos un modelo de contribución federado, donde los equipos de producto pueden proponer mejoras basadas en datos reales de uso, las cuales son evaluadas e integradas por el equipo del sistema.

Este enfoque dinámico permite que el sistema responda a las nuevas necesidades del mercado sin perder la integridad. La implementación técnica suele apoyarse en herramientas como Storybook, que permite visualizar y testear componentes de forma aislada. Esto es fundamental para garantizar que el código sea modular y testeable, evitando el temido efecto dominó donde un cambio en un botón rompe el layout del carrito de compra. La integración continua y el despliegue continuo (CI/CD) se aplican aquí con el mismo rigor que en el backend de una aplicación financiera.

El beneficio final para el cliente es la agilidad. En un mercado donde la competencia puede lanzar una funcionalidad similar a la tuya en semanas, tener la capacidad de prototipar con componentes reales y lanzarlos a producción con la seguridad de que no habrá fallos visuales ni técnicos es el mayor valor estratégico que podemos ofrecer. El Desarrollo de Sistemas de Diseño transforma el departamento de IT y diseño de un centro de costes a un motor de innovación.


Hacia una cultura de producto unificada

Implementar un sistema de diseño no es solo un cambio tecnológico, es un cambio cultural. Requiere que los diseñadores piensen en términos de variables y estados, y que los desarrolladores se involucren en la toma de decisiones estéticas y de usabilidad. En OUNTI, actuamos como el puente que une estas dos disciplinas. Entendemos que el éxito de una plataforma digital no reside en la genialidad de un diseño aislado, sino en la solidez de la infraestructura que lo sustenta.

Para las empresas que buscan una ventaja sostenible, la pregunta no es si necesitan un sistema de diseño, sino cuánto tiempo pueden permitirse seguir sin uno. La inversión inicial se recupera rápidamente mediante la reducción de errores en producción, la aceleración de los ciclos de lanzamiento y, sobre todo, una experiencia de usuario que genera lealtad y conversión. El Desarrollo de Sistemas de Diseño es, en última instancia, el compromiso de una marca con la excelencia operativa y la calidad del servicio al cliente en cada punto de contacto digital.

A medida que avanzamos hacia interfaces más inmersivas y personalizadas, la base que construimos hoy determinará nuestra capacidad de adaptación mañana. Un sistema bien ejecutado es la base sobre la cual se construye el futuro de la interacción humana con la tecnología, permitiendo que la creatividad se enfoque en resolver problemas complejos mientras la consistencia y la implementación se vuelven, por fin, un proceso natural y fluido.

Andrei A. Andrei A.

¿Necesitas ayuda con tu proyecto?

Nos encantaría ayudarte. Somos capaces de crear proyectos a gran escala.